‘Walking Dead’ War: Creator Robert Kirkman Sued By Collaborator

0

Robert Kirkman, the famed comic book writer who helped create AMC’s hit zombie series The Walking Dead,
has been sued by a childhood friend and collaborator who claims he is
entitled to as much as half the proceeds from the lucrative franchise.

Michael Anthony (“Tony”) Moore, a fellow comic book
artist, filed suit Thursday in Los Angeles Superior Court. In the
complaint, a copy of which was obtained by THR, Moore says he
was duped into assigning his interest in the material over to Kirkman,
who has since gone on to fame and fortune. Moore, on the other hand, has
received very little compensation and has not be able to access profit
statements from properties including Walking Dead, he says.
